Abstract
The aquatic hyphomycetes showed a characteristic pattern of colonization on baited branches of Callistemon citrinus and culms of Saccharum bengalense in tropical irrigation water channels in Lahore. A total of twelve species of aquatic hyphomycetes colonized these substrata. Some of the species could be identified as early or late colonizers on these baited materials. Sporidesmium ensiforme and Mycofalcella iqbalii showed the most distinctive pattern. Sporidesmium ensiforme was the early colonizer and showed maximum colonization during the first two weeks and then it declined while M. iqbalii colonized it in the second week with increasing colonization till the end of baiting period. Other early colonizer species included Lemonniera aquatica and an unidentified species Sp C whereas Articulospora proliferata and Flagellospora fusarioides appeared to be the late colonizers.
